Household of Evert van den Born

He is married to Willemina Hillegonda Fijnvandraat.

Permission for the marriage has been obtained in Harderwijk on March 22, 1863.Source 3

They got married on April 8, 1863 at Harderwijk, he was 32 years old.Source 3

Getuigen:
Willem Fijnvandraat, 39 jaar, bakker, broer bruid
Evert Fijnvandraat, 32 jaar, bakker, broer bruid
Evert Fijnvandraat, 28 jaar, winkelier, neef bruid
Michiel Johan de Lange, 40 jaar, gymnasi lector, aangetrouwde neef bruid

Child(ren):

  1. Jan van den Born  1864-1934 
  2. Willem van den Born  1867-1937 
  3. Maria van den Born  1869-1964 
  4. Willemina van den Born  1872-1939 


Notes about Evert van den Born

Beroep: korenmolenaar (1898)

Evert is eigenaar van molen "De Hoop" in Harderwijk als die voor de tweede maal afbrandt. De eerste keer (in 1884) was zijn vader huurder van die molen. In 1969 brandt de molen definitief af.
